| Aspect | Contractual Grade Control Geologist | Geotechnical Engineer |
|---|---|---|
| Credentials | Bachelor's in Geology, Geoscience, or related field; certifications vary | Bachelor's or Master's in Civil or Geotechnical Engineering; PE license often preferred |
| Work Environment | Mining sites, exploration projects, geological surveys | Construction sites, infrastructure projects, soil and rock analysis |
| Industry Usage | Common in mining and mineral exploration companies | Used across construction, infrastructure, and environmental sectors |
The Contractual Grade Control Geologist primarily focuses on geological assessments and grade control in mining operations, while the Geotechnical Engineer specializes in analyzing soil and rock stability for construction projects. Both roles require technical expertise but differ in industry focus and specific responsibilities.

Role Overview
We are seeking a technically skilled and field-oriented Mining Geologist to support mineral exploration, deposit modelling, and development planning across Northwestern Colorado. The ideal candidate will bring strong field mapping skills, experience with geological modelling and resource estimation, and the ability to collaborate with multidisciplinary teams to inform project strategy.
This is a full-time, in-office role based in the Grand Junction area of Northwestern Colorado and includes occasional travel. A relocation allowance is available.
Northwestern Colorado offers a high quality of life with stunning natural beauty, year-round outdoor activities, and easy access to Aspen, Vail, Denver and other regional attractions, without the high cost of living. The area boasts excellent healthcare, strong community infrastructure, and convenient regional airports with direct flights to major cities.
Key Responsibilities
· Conduct geological mapping, sampling programs, and site evaluations to assess mineralization
· Contribute to the development and interpretation of geologic models using drilling and field data
· Support resource estimations, ore body delineation, and grade control strategies
· Collaborate with mining engineers and project managers to inform mine design and development planning
· Compile and analyze geological data for technical reporting, regulatory submissions, and internal planning
· Monitor and support exploration drilling programs with accurate core logging and lithological descriptions
· Maintain geologic databases and ensure data integrity across modeling and reporting workflows
· Stay informed on regional geology, stratigraphy, and mineral resource opportunities within key Colorado basins
Qualifications
· Bachelor’s degree in Geology, Geological Engineering, or Earth Sciences
· P.G. (Professional Geologist) license or eligibility strongly preferred
· 4+ years of experience in mineral exploration, mining geology, or geologic modeling
· Familiarity with the geology of the Piceance or similar mineral-rich formations
· Proficiency in geologic modelling and GIS software (e.g., Leapfrog, Surfer, ArcGIS, Datamine)
Key Competencies
· Understanding of mineral deposit identification, geological mapping, sampling techniques, and exploration programs across a variety of geological settings.
· Experience using geological software such as Leapfrog, Surfer, or similar platforms to develop and maintain 2D and 3D geological models.
· Ability to accurately log drill core, interpret lithologies, and document geological observations to support exploration and resource evaluation activities.
· Resource Estimation & Grade Control: Experience supporting or conducting mineral resource estimations and contributing to grade control programs through data interpretation and modelling.
· Experience contributing to mineral resource estimation and grade control programs through data collection, interpretation, and geological modelling.
· Western Colorado Basin Expertise: Familiarity with the geology, mineral potential, and stratigraphy of the Piceance or comparable regions is an asset.
· Ability to maintain accurate geological records, manage exploration data, and analyze information to support project objectives and decision-making.
· Effective Communication: Strong written and verbal communication skills to present complex geological findings clearly to both technical and non-technical stakeholders.
· Team Collaboration & Leadership: Demonstrated ability to work effectively in cross-functional teams, mentor junior staff, and contribute to a positive and performance-driven work culture.
· Regulatory & Environmental Awareness: Knowledge of permitting requirements, environmental standards, and best practices for responsible mineral exploration and development.
